Interpretation Introduction
Interpretation:
Whether the concerted model accounts for the given negative cooperativity or not is to be stated.
Concept introduction:
The concerted model suggests that subunits of enzymes are arranged in such connection in which any conformational change in any of the subunit is compulsorily granted to all the subunits.
